1. Architecture independent massive parallelization of divide-and-conquer algorithms;Achatz,1995
2. Massive parallelization of divide-and-conquer algorithms over powerlists;Achatz,1995
3. Sorting networks and their applications;Batcher,1968
4. Lectures on constructive functional programming;Bird,1989
5. NESL: A nested data-parallel language;Blelloch,1992